Overview:
The ManagedMethods Cloud Monitor platform contains a wide variety of domain data which often times includes risky, sensitive or confidential content. It's important to protect resources that expose this level of user detail. One layer of protection can be covered by ensuring platform account(s) login access is applied appropriately.
Detail:
Google's SSO is an effective way to provide additional security measures during login attempts. The platform has settings to allow for login with username and password or SSO. Platform "Super Admins" have ability to enforce the Google SSO option during login for any account.
Enforce SSO:
Navigate to the "Admin" section then select "Users". Clicking the edit "Pencil" icon next to an account provides access for enforcing SSO.
From the edit section toggle the "Enforce Google Sign On" option and "Save".
Note:
- Enabling this setting restricts accounts from using or generating username and password for login.
